Like I said, at least IMO the 38.5s are the perfect size. And for the back order stuff, when you get in to this size of a tire dealers don't typically stock them. Summit wasn't even selling them at the time that I bought them! I had to have them reactivate that size so I could buy a set. It took about a week for them to come in. If you go with a tire of this size range, expect to wait for them.
